Output 59e7cbd01d32b50917ab7ef49f4fafcbb7a8a4f8564155a7af0c187497619c9c:9

value
22576
script pubkey
OP_0 OP_PUSHBYTES_20 abdf9c49dbf7c1b01a502981ce16e068828c5603
address
bc1q400ecjwm7lqmqxjs9xquu9hqdzpgc4srlcgnrs
transaction
59e7cbd01d32b50917ab7ef49f4fafcbb7a8a4f8564155a7af0c187497619c9c
confirmations
92672
spent
true